#e4723e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#e4723e is composed of 89.4% red, 44.7% green and 24.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 50% magenta, 72.8% yellow and 10.6% black. It has a hue angle of 18.8 degrees, a saturation of 75.5% and a lightness of 56.9%. #e4723e color hex could be obtained by blending #ffe47c with #c90000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6633.

Shades and Tints of #e4723e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d0602 is the darkest color, while #fefcfb is the lightest one.

Tones of #e4723e

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#988e8a is the less saturated color, while #fd6925 is the most saturated one.
